help, how to simulate output impedance of balun with cadence
i'm designing a RFPA. At the input side a balun is used to convert single-ended signal to differential signal.
i have two questions:
1. i think the input impedance Zin of transistor should be conjugate matched to source impedance Zs, am i right?
2. to get Zs, i must know the output impedance of balun Ztr. i wanna make a AC-simulation and Ztr=V/I.
but when a input signal is added to PORT and a resistence R is added at the right side of balun, the simulated impedance is always equal to R (i.e. the impedance looking to right side, but what i want is the impedance looking to left side). How should i setup the testbench?

Why don't you make a s-paameters simulation instead of AC to get the reflection coefficient and then impedances ?
If you know the reflection compare to characteristic impedance, after that you can get the real impedance.

if i understand correctly, each of differential terminate is connected with a port(port number =2 and 3) and i make a SP-simulation,
impedance can be computed according to Ztr_1=Z0*(1-S22)/(1+S22); Ztr_2=Z0*(1-S33)/(1+S33), is it right?
but i'm confused it is the impedance looking to left or right, have i the correct S-parameter selected?
